Nuclear Medicine Technologist Salary in Draper, UT: $97,150 (2026)
Quick Answer:A full-time nuclear medicine technologist in Draper, UT earns a median $97,150/year (≈ $46.71/hour) in nominal terms for 2026 — projected from BLS OEWS 2025 (SOC 29-2033). Once you factor in Draper's price level (2% below national, BEA RPP 98.1), that paycheck buys what $99,032 would nationally. Nominal pay sits 0.3% below the Utah state average.
Based on BLS state-level estimates · View source

In 2026, a nuclear medicine technologist in Draper, Utah, can expect to earn a median annual salary of $97,150, which lags behind the national median of $106,398 by about 8.69%. The salaries in the area span from $72,460 at the 10th percentile to $126,779 at the 90th percentile. Nuclear Medicine Technologist Job Market in Draper
Currently, the nuclear medicine technologist workforce in Draper consists of around 10 professionals, indicating a tight-knit market environment. The cost of living index in Draper is at 98.1, slightly below the national average, which affects the purchasing power of salaries. Facilities such as outpatient PET/CT imaging centers typically offer higher compensation compared to hospitals or mobile imaging companies. The pay variance among technologists can be attributed to various factors, including certification differences, experience with theranostics, on-call demands, and the necessity for cross-training in CT. To maximize their salary prospects in Draper UT, technologists should focus on acquiring PET/CT certifications and seeking positions in outpatient imaging centers, which tend to offer superior pay, enhanced job stability, and growth opportunities in a thriving field.
